aboutsummaryrefslogtreecommitdiff
path: root/examples/GuiClient/rosterItem.cpp
diff options
context:
space:
mode:
authorManjeet Dahiya <manjeetdahiya@gmail.com>2010-09-09 07:21:21 +0000
committerManjeet Dahiya <manjeetdahiya@gmail.com>2010-09-09 07:21:21 +0000
commitb57381204cbb00aa27c5f74478ab7d430441ceb1 (patch)
treea91d2a38ba408ef69fb89b8b2e5b5b0e266e53a5 /examples/GuiClient/rosterItem.cpp
parente5118d03144ae3c6fdb847eb8eae716cdf66f23d (diff)
downloadqxmpp-b57381204cbb00aa27c5f74478ab7d430441ceb1.tar.gz
statusText eliding
Diffstat (limited to 'examples/GuiClient/rosterItem.cpp')
-rw-r--r--examples/GuiClient/rosterItem.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/examples/GuiClient/rosterItem.cpp b/examples/GuiClient/rosterItem.cpp
index 7b1ce758..2831198f 100644
--- a/examples/GuiClient/rosterItem.cpp
+++ b/examples/GuiClient/rosterItem.cpp
@@ -200,7 +200,7 @@ void ItemDelegate::paint(QPainter* painter, const QStyleOptionViewItem& option,
rect.moveTop(rect.y() - 3);
QString statusText = index.data(rosterItem::StatusText).toString();
QFontMetrics fontMetrics(font);
- statusText = fontMetrics.elidedText(statusText, Qt::ElideRight, rect.width());
+ statusText = fontMetrics.elidedText(statusText, Qt::ElideRight, rect.width() - 34);
painter->drawText(rect, statusText);
penDivision.setWidth(0);